To earn a high school diploma in Ontario, students must: earn 18 compulsory credits. earn 12 optional credits. pass the literacy requirement. earn at least two online learning credits. complete a minimum of 40 hours of …

WebJun 28, 2016 · The student needs to fulfill a minimum number of credits in order to graduate from high school. Traditionally, 1 credit in high school equals 120 hours of classwork, or 160 45-minute periods. Labs and projects, field trips, …

Most students in Texas need 26 credits to graduate high school. This includes 4 credits in English, 3 credits in math, 3 credits in science, 3 credits in social studies, 1 credit in physical education, and 1 credit in health.
